County Lines is a term used to describe gangs and organised criminal networks involved in exporting illegal drugs into one or more importing areas in the UK, using dedicated mobile phone lines or other form of "deal line".

Northumbria Police have provided information in the leaflet below on the warning signs for parents/carers to look out for and tips on what you can do if you have concerns. At the bottom of the document, contact numbers/email addresses are provided for people to seek help, advice or guidance with anything County Lines related.
